There really are fish all over the harbor...
Fish the back end oyster bars and creeks for reds.
Grass on the north side for trout and reds.
and dont forget the boat docks.

Go over to SunnSurf Rd, its located in northeast end. You can also put in at HWY 98 and there is a public ramp about a 1/4 mile from the Marina.
